首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

计算年龄并检查值是否正常

是一个常见的编程任务,涉及到输入用户的生日信息,然后通过计算当前日期与生日日期之间的差值来得到年龄。以下是一个完善且全面的答案:

计算年龄并检查值是否正常可以通过以下步骤实现:

  1. 首先,获取用户输入的生日日期。这可以通过前端开发技术实现,例如使用HTML的日期选择器或自定义日期输入框。
  2. 将用户输入的生日日期转换为计算机可识别的日期格式。可以使用前端开发语言(如JavaScript)的日期对象进行转换。
  3. 使用当前日期减去用户生日日期,得到时间差。这可以通过编程语言中的日期运算功能实现。
  4. 将时间差转换为年龄。根据具体编程语言和库的不同,可以使用日期运算功能或自定义计算方法来得到年龄。
  5. 检查计算得到的年龄是否在合理的范围内。根据实际需求,可以定义一个最小年龄和最大年龄,然后对计算得到的年龄进行比较。
  6. 根据检查结果,给出相应的提示或处理。如果年龄超出了合理范围,可以要求用户重新输入生日日期或给出警告信息。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 如果需要在前端实现日期选择器,腾讯云的小程序开发框架 WXML 可以使用 <picker mode="date"> 组件进行日期选择。详情请参考小程序开发文档
  • 对于日期的转换和计算,可以使用 JavaScript 的日期对象和相关函数进行操作,无需腾讯云产品支持。
  • 检查年龄是否在合理范围内是一个简单的逻辑判断,不需要腾讯云产品支持。

请注意,本答案中并未涉及云计算领域的具体知识和产品,因为计算年龄并检查值是否正常并不需要云计算领域的专业知识或相关产品的支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 如何检查 Java 数组中是否包含某个

    参考链接: Java程序检查数组是否包含给定 作者 |  沉默王二  本文经授权转载自沉默王二(ID:cmower)  在逛 programcreek 的时候,我发现了一些专注细节但价值连城的主题。...比如说:如何检查Java数组中是否包含某个 ?像这类灵魂拷问的主题,非常值得深入地研究一下。  另外,我想要告诉大家的是,作为程序员,我们千万不要轻视这些基础的知识点。...如何检查数组(未排序)中是否包含某个 ?这是一个非常有用并且经常使用的操作。我想大家的脑海中应该已经浮现出来了几种解决方案,这些方案的时间复杂度可能大不相同。  ...我先来提供四种不同的方法,大家看看是否高效。  ...实际上,如果要在一个数组或者集合中有效地确定某个是否存在,一个排序过的 List 的算法复杂度为 O(logn),而 HashSet 则为 O(1)。

    9K20

    灵魂拷问:如何检查Java数组中是否包含某个

    比如说:如何检查Java数组中是否包含某个 ?像这类灵魂拷问的主题,非常值得深入地研究一下。 另外,我想要告诉大家的是,作为程序员,我们千万不要轻视这些基础的知识点。...如何检查数组(未排序)中是否包含某个 ?这是一个非常有用并且经常使用的操作。我想大家的脑海中应该已经浮现出来了几种解决方案,这些方案的时间复杂度可能大不相同。...我先来提供四种不同的方法,大家看看是否高效。...HashSet 对象后,其实是在 HashMap 的键中放入了数组的,只不过 HashMap 的为默认的一个摆设对象。...实际上,如果要在一个数组或者集合中有效地确定某个是否存在,一个排序过的 List 的算法复杂度为 O(logn),而 HashSet 则为 O(1)。

    4.8K20

    如何在 Windows 中检查计算正常运行时间

    如何使用任务管理器检查 Windows 正常运行时间 任务管理器是用于检查正在运行的进程和服务及其详细信息的工具。还可以找到有关资源利用率的详细信息,例如运行时的内存和 CPU 使用情况。...这也是 Windows 用户查找计算正常运行时间的一种快速且首选的方式。 打开任务管理器,点击性能,点击cpu,就可以看到“正常运行时间”了。 上图显示计算机开机已经3天11小时了。...使用命令行检查计算正常运行时间 还可以使用命令行选项查看 Windows 正常运行时间。下面使用wmic和systeminfo两个命令来查看windows正常运行时间。 A....使用systeminfo命令 systeminfo 命令显示有关操作系统、计算机软件和硬件组件的详细信息列表。可以用它查询“系统启动时间”的,以获得计算机的正常运行时间。...Windows 正常运行时间 启动 Powershell 输入以下命令以查找当前系统的最后一次重启时间。

    2.7K30

    怎么检查计算机和打印机是否连接网络,检查电脑是否正确连接网络打印机

    那么这个时候应该怎么检查电脑中是否已成功连接网络打印机?对此,我们可以参考以下方法来进行操作。...打开打印对话框,在打印机名称中看看有没有网络打印机的名称,如果没有则说明打印机驱动有问题,需要重新安装网络打印机的驱动程序; 2、如果有显示打印机名称,那么问题有可能是网络连接错误或者打印机故障; 3、如果电脑能正常上网说明网络连接没有问题...,还可以通过命令测试电脑与网络打印机是否是联机状态:按Win+R打开运行,输入cmd并回车; 4、查看网络打印机的IP地址,可以在打印机对话框中进行查看; 5、就可以在命令提示符中输入ping 192.168.1.234...以上便是检查电脑中是否已成功连接网络打印机的方法,大家可以通过以上方法来操作。

    4.9K40

    在 Windows 服务器中检查计算正常运行时间

    如何使用任务管理器检查 Windows 正常运行时间 任务管理器是用于检查正在运行的进程和服务及其详细信息的工具。还可以找到有关资源利用率的详细信息,例如运行时的内存和 CPU 使用情况。...这也是 Windows 用户查找计算正常运行时间的一种快速且首选的方式。 打开任务管理器,点击性能,点击cpu,就可以看到“正常运行时间”了。 上图显示计算机开机已经3天11小时了。...使用命令行检查计算正常运行时间 还可以使用命令行选项查看 Windows 正常运行时间。下面使用wmic和systeminfo两个命令来查看windows正常运行时间。 A....使用systeminfo命令 systeminfo 命令显示有关操作系统、计算机软件和硬件组件的详细信息列表。可以用它查询“系统启动时间”的,以获得计算机的正常运行时间。...Windows 正常运行时间 启动 Powershell 输入以下命令以查找当前系统的最后一次重启时间。

    4.1K30

    检查边长度限制的路径是否存在(排序+查集)

    给你一个查询数组queries ,其中 queries[j] = [pj, qj, limitj] ,你的任务是对于每个查询 queries[j] ,判断是否存在从 pj 到 qj 的路径,且这条路径上的每一条边都...请你返回一个 布尔数组 answer ,其中 answer.length == queries.length ,当 queries[j] 的查询结果为 true 时, answer 第 j 个为 true...岛屿数量 II(查集) LeetCode 323. 无向图中连通分量的数目(查集) LeetCode 684. 冗余连接(查集) LeetCode 685....冗余连接 II(查集) LeetCode 721. 账户合并(查集)(字符串合并) LeetCode 737. 句子相似性 II(查集) LeetCode 886....等式方程的可满足性(查集) LeetCode 959. 由斜杠划分区域(查集) LeetCode 1061. 按字典序排列最小的等效字符串(查集) LeetCode 1101.

    1.1K10

    【Leetcode -2236.判断根节点是否等于子节点之和 -2331.计算布尔二叉树的

    Leetcode -2236.判断根节点是否等于子节点之和 题目:给你一个 二叉树 的根结点 root,该二叉树由恰好 3 个结点组成:根结点、左子结点和右子结点。...提示: 树只包含根结点、左子结点和右子结点 100 <= Node.val <= 100 思路:直接返回判断根的是否等于左节点和右节点 val 之和; bool checkTree(struct...TreeNode* root) { //直接返回判断根的是否等于左节点和右节点 val 之和 return root->val == root->left->val +...root->right->val; } Leetcode -2331.计算布尔二叉树的 题目:给你一棵 完整二叉树 的根,这棵树有以下特征: 叶子节点 要么为 0 要么为 1 ,其中 0 表示...计算 一个节点的方式如下: 如果节点是个叶子节点,那么节点的 为它本身,即 True 或者 False 。 否则,计算 两个孩子的节点,然后将该节点的运算符对两个孩子进行 运算 。

    9310

    GEE 案例——如何计算sentinel-2中每一个单景影像的波段的DN绘制直方图

    原始问题 我正试图在 Google 地球引擎中为整个图像集合计算一个直方图。为了达到我想要的结果,我现在所做的是计算每个单独图像的直方图直方图1 并将它们相加,不知道是否正确。...简介 直方图基本上是一个配对列表。因此,您可以用函数映射它,而无需 for/ 循环。以下代码片段包含了为整个图像集生成直方图的算法的重要部分。...创建一个聚类器,使用固定数量、固定宽度的分隔来计算输入的直方图。超出 [min, max] 范围的将被忽略。输出是一个 Nx2 数组,包含桶下边缘和计数(或累计计数),适合按像素使用。...计算绘制图像指定区域内色带的直方图。 X 轴 直方图桶(带)。 Y 轴 频率(带在桶中的像素数量)。 Returns a chart.

    16510

    成功实现MDK自动生成hex文件的crc附加到hex文件末尾(bin也支持),然后跟STM32的硬件CRC计算做比较

    通过这种方式,可以实时检查程序的完整性,防止盗取程序时对程序的修改。 也可以用来验证程序的完整性,特别是IAP升级等场合。...【操作步骤】 注意,我是按照我们的工程操作的,其它工程大家自行做适配,推荐将CRC放在扇区末尾,方便程序设计和配置。...0x08000000 0x0801FFFC -STM32_Little_Endian 0x0801FFFC   : 计算0x08000000 到 0x0801FFFC的CRC,以小端格式存储到地址0x0801FFFC...程序首地址 */ #define BOOT_LEN 0x0001FFFC /* 程序大小 */ #define BOOT_CRCADDR 0x0801FFFC /* bin文件的CRC计算存储的位置...= HAL_OK) { Error_Handler(__FILE__, __LINE__); } /* 计算是否与硬件CRC一致 */

    3K20

    重度抑郁症患者的脑功能老化加速:来自中国大规模fMRI证据

    我们进一步提出了一个叠加模型,结合三种算法的结果,以达到更优的年龄估计。我们对每个算法得到的结果进行单独的分析,以检查得出的结论的鲁棒性。...所有重度抑郁症患者都是在医院确诊的,至少进行了t1加权结构扫描和rsfMRI扫描。所有受试者同意提供诊断、年龄、性别和受教育年限。...由于本研究的目的是探索正常对照组和MDD患者之间潜在的脑年龄差异,我们分别估计了两组患者的脑年龄。模型在由正常对照组成的保持验证集中进行训练和测试。...,我们训练了一个线性回归模型来校正大脑年龄偏差。我们计算实际年龄和持有验证集上的估计年龄之间的回归线。然后利用回归线的斜率和截距来调整测试集的脑预测年龄。此过程的步骤见补充资料S4。...验证集和测试集上的实际年龄和预测年龄的相关性如图2a、b所示。图2 实际年龄与预测年龄之间的相关性3.2 正常控制的相对特征重要性我们计算功能连通性特征与年龄之间的相关性(补充图S4)。

    68830

    R语言逻辑回归、Naive Bayes贝叶斯、决策树、随机森林算法预测心脏病

    目标 "字段是指病人是否有心脏病。它的数值为整数,0=无病,1=有病。 目标: 主要目的是预测给定的人是否有心脏病,借助于几个因素,如年龄、胆固醇水平、胸痛类型等。...1=正常;2=固定缺陷;3=可逆转缺陷 目标--预测属性--心脏疾病的诊断(血管造影疾病状态)(0=50%直径狭窄) 在Rstudio中加载数据 heart<-read.csv...这个函数是用来检查我们的数据是否包含任何NA。 如果没有发现NA,我们就可以继续前进,否则我们就必须在之前删除NA。 检查我们的数据结构 str(heart) ?...为了检查我们的模型是如何生成的,我们需要计算预测分数和建立混淆矩阵来了解模型的准确性。 pred<-fitted(blr) # 拟合只能用于获得生成模型的数据的预测分数。 ?...用训练数据检查模型,创建其混淆矩阵,来了解模型的准确程度。 predict(train) confMat(pred,target) ? ? 我们可以说,贝叶斯算法对训练数据的准确率为85.46%。

    1.6K30
    领券